Thank you for your input. David Fox CEO responses:
1. Yes, Stellar is not just around, but experiencing growth and positive change as we build the team who will change this industry in months and years to come. We announced via press release two months ago where we raised a $26.3m Series A from some of the largest and most astute investors in the world.
2. Yes, we've pivoted as many start ups do to find the right product market fit and partnerships which is what led to our Series A investment. Good leadership tends to find a way to make things happen, raise money to build the business (think talent acquisition/recruiting), and find the right strategic partners to accelerate growth. With this round of funding we've been able to attract top talent and are very excited about the future of the company.
3. I'm very confident we can run Stellar effectively and have appropriate back grounds for success. Here is our leadership background: My family background in aviation dates back 3 generations to 1934 and I have been CEO of 2 other successful technology companies. My co-founding partner Paul Touw, founded XoJet (the largest operator in the country) and founded Ariba.. Our Lead investors CEP led Bain's Aviation practice and founded Volaris Airlines, now publicly traded. Our other Board members, Dave Siegel, ran Frontier Airlines, US Airways, Avis. Shawn Vick is the CEO of Global Jet Capital, funded in part by Carlyle who has one of the largest Aerospace PE funds in existence. So, I certainly think we've got some teammates around the table that have done some stuff in tech and aviation in their careers.
